#5412d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5412d4 is composed of 32.9% red, 7.1%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.4% cyan, 91.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 260.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 45.1%. #5412d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#a824ff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#5412d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5412d4 has RGB values of R:84, G:18,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 5509844.

Shades and Tints of #5412d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010d is the darkest color, while #fcf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5412d4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706a7c is the less saturated color, while #4e00e6 is the most saturated one.
